Problem

The integration of automatic driving into mixed road environments where sections require manual driving intervention or automatic driving is challenging, leading to potential vehicle stops and disruptions in social activities.

Innovation Solution

An information processing apparatus that acquires traveling route information and traffic information to display driver intervention requiring sections and automatic driving available sections on a reach prediction time axis, allowing for precise timing of driver intervention and reducing the burden on road infrastructure.

AI summary

Section information of a traveling route is provided appropriately to a driver. Traveling route information and traffic information relating to the traveling route are acquired, and on the basis of the information, a driver intervention requiring section and an automatic driving available section of the traveling route are displayed on a reach prediction time axis from a current point on an instrument panel, a tablet, or the like. For example, the driver intervention requiring section includes a manual driving section, a takeover section from automatic driving to manual driving, and a cautious traveling section from the automatic driving.
